We had a wonderful dinner at Maison Mère earlier in our week in St. Martin. The food was excellent and the service was amazing, but that wasn’t ultimately what won us over.
We were celebrating our anniversary on this trip and chose a different restaurant for the actual night. I noted the occasion when we booked and again when we arrived, but they didn’t make a single attempt to acknowledge it. Their response was simply, “Oh yeah, there are so many anniversaries here tonight.” We left there super disappointed.
On the way back, we decided to return to Maison Mère for coffee and dessert, hoping to salvage the evening since our first visit had been so impressive. When I told the hostess why we were coming back, she immediately welcomed us with genuine warmth.
A few minutes after our coffee arrived, the entire staff came to our table with sparklers, dessert, and big smiles, all wishing us a happy anniversary. They turned our night into something special and memorable.
Maison Mère didn’t just serve incredible food, they rescued our anniversary dinner celebration. Their heart, hospitality, and attention to the moments that matter will keep us coming back every time we’re in St. Martin. Highly recommend.

An absolute must do if you are visiting Orient Bay
The Filet de Bœuf Hemingway au Poivre Noir was, without question, the highlight of the night. Perfectly cooked, beautifully seasoned, and complemented by a rich peppercorn cream sauce. That said, the Pork Belly from Cantal came in a close second. Crisped to perfection and paired with ultra-creamy mushroom polenta, it was indulgent and incredibly satisfying.
Service was warm, attentive, and well-paced, adding to the overall ease and enjoyment of the evening. The space itself is stylish yet cozy, with a mix of indoor and outdoor seating nestled beneath lush greenery and twinkling lights.
We wrapped up the meal with a delightful digestif, served on what looked like a vintage book, but was actually the portal for our check—such a charming final touch.
Maison Mère is a gem, and we’ll absolutely be recommending it to anyone visiting St. Martin. It’s the kind of place that manages to balance elevated cuisine with laid-back island elegance—an experience worth savoring.
